Buchner Funnel
CoorsTekThe CoorsTek Buchner funnel is used for separation and filtration of solids from liquids. The fixed perforated plate at the bottom contains small pores that allow the liquid to pass through while retaining the solid particles. It has glazed inside and out except for rim. Alumina Crucibles
CoorsTekChoose from high form, conical and cylindrical 99.8% Al2O3 Withstands temperatures up to 1,750°C Uses covers Useful for determinations involving molybdenum, platinum, rhodium, tungsten, tantalum and iridium.

Crucible Cover 31 Coors Proc
CoorsTekManufactured from 99.8% pure aluminum oxide, these crucible covers are highly resistant to chemicals, alkalines, and other fluxes. Crucible cover is inactive in hydrogen and carbonaceous atmospheres. Withstands temperatures to 3182°F (1750°C). Crucibles sold separately. Autoclavable.

Cylindrical Crucible Coors Proc
CoorsTekAlumina crucibles are inert in hydrogen and carbonaceous atmospheres and offers high resistance to alkalies and other fluxes. Suitable for glass melting, including borosilicate glass. CoorsTek® AD-998 High-Alumina labware cylindrical-shaped crucible is made of 99.8%-pure aluminum oxide
